Me WHEREAS, on September 9, 1997, the Little Rock Board of Directors adopted Little Rock Resolution No. 10,074 which placed a ninety (90) day moratorium on the acceptance and processing of wireless communications facilities ( "WCF ") permits; and WHEREAS, during the ninety day period City staff has received numerous comments and suggestions from the public concerning the draft ordinance that was attached to the resolution and distributed to the public; and WHEREAS, the City is still receiving input from the public on the proposed WCF regulations but the Planning Commission has not had an opportunity to review and make a recommendation on the ordinance; and WHEREAS, the matter has been placed on the December 18, 1997, Planning Commission Agenda for consideration; and WHEREAS, it is necessary that the moratorium be extended until January 15, 1998, to allow time for Planning Commission review and recommendation and Board of Directors' approval of the WCF regulations. N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ED BY THE LITTLE ROCK BOARD OF DIRECTORS OF THE CITY OF LITTLE ROCK, ARKANSAS: SECTION 1. The moratorium on the placement of WCF permit applications on the Planning Commission agenda is hereby extended to January 15, 1998. SECTION 2. During the extended period City staff may accept and process applications for WCF permits. ADOPTED: December 2, 1997 ATTEST: ROBBIE HANCOCK CITY CLERK APP OVED AS TO FORM: THOMAS M.
